IUPUI 88, IPFW 74
INDIANAPOLIS -- John Hart scored 26 points and IUPUI scored 21 of the game's last 23 points to beat IPFW 88-74 Thursday night.
The Jaguars (6-10, 1-2 Summit League), who shot 72 percent from the field in the second half, had four other players score in double figures. Greg Rice had 16 points, Lyonell Gaines and Donovan Gibbs scored 12 apiece and Mitchell Patton had 10 points in 15 minutes off the bench.
IUPUI shot 59 percent from the field overall. It was 39-39 at halftime and the Jaguars trailed 72-67 with 6 minutes remaining then outscored the Mastodons 21-2 the rest of the way. Gaines had eight points in that run.
Frank Gaines had 28 points for IPFW (6-8, 0-1), but he was the only Mastodon to score in double digits. Fort Wayne shot 49 percent from the field.
The final score was the Jaguars' largest lead of the game.
